About the role

Key responsibilities & impact
  • Support end-user workstation hardware and software for the agency
  • Troubleshoot technical issues in person, on-site, and remotely through the service desk and ticket handling system
  • Respond to and handle service desk alerts, walk-ins, calls, and emails
  • Coordinate equipment pickup and drop-offs
  • Triage service desk calls and determine escalations
  • Conduct IT site visits and remotely assist employees with troubleshooting
  • Document issues and solutions in ITSM tools and OneNote
  • Train end-users on basic software, hardware, and peripheral device operation
  • Maintain and service desktops, laptops, company mobile devices, and desk phones; coordinate replacements
  • Manage inventory, device locations, check-ins, check-outs, reconditioning, decommissioning, and archiving
  • Maintain end-user device security and compliance using Windows Updates and WSUS; perform reimaging
  • Administer Active Directory accounts, including creation, password resets, and multifactor authentication
  • Participate in the computer incident response plan
  • Work with stakeholders to understand needs and concerns and communicate technical matters at a non-technical level
  • Perform additional duties assigned by management

Requirements

What you’ll need
  • High School Diploma or equivalent required
  • Minimum of 2 years’ experience in desktop support in a mid-to-large work environment
  • Knowledge of Microsoft Operating Systems, Office Products, and networking concepts required
  • IT experience within a healthcare organization is preferred
  • CompTIA A+ certification is preferred
  • ITIL v4 Foundations is a plus
  • Excellent time management skills and ability to meet deadlines
  • Strong attention to detail
  • Critical thinking capability
  • Excellent verbal and written communication skills
  • Exceptional customer service skills
  • Proactive and independent with ability to take initiative
  • Excellent organizational skills
  • Must be a resident of the Phoenix, AZ area
  • If driving on agency time or business, valid Arizona driver license, appropriate liability insurance, and approval for liability coverage are required
  • At hire, a 3-year state driving record with no major infractions or excessive violations/tickets is required
  • Ability to lift at least 30 pounds and move desktops, laptops, and monitors
  • Ability to perform occasional heavy lifting in a team-lift scenario
  • Ability to drive a company van and maintain driving ability during employment
  • Ability to work staggered schedules as needed
  • Ability to travel to other EMPACT locations
